A reduced-pressure principle (RP) backflow assembly is installed on a service subject to a health hazard. How must it be installed with respect to the ground and drainage?

a.Below grade in a valve box
b.Flush to a wall with the relief plugged
c.Any orientation as long as it is accessible
d.Above grade with the relief port able to discharge to atmosphere

Giải thích

An RP assembly must be installed above grade with an air gap below its relief port so the relief can discharge freely and be observed; it may not be submerged in a pit that could flood the relief. RP assemblies protect against both backsiphonage and backpressure of high-hazard (health) cross connections. Submerging or plugging the relief defeats the protection.

Trích dẫn luật: UPC §603.0
